Taste the Heart of the City: Jozi Kota Festival 2026
Prepare your appetite for Johannesburg’s ultimate street food celebration. The Jozi Kota Festival returns this April, transforming Newtown into a vibrant hub of culinary creativity and local culture. This event is a tribute to the humble kota, elevated by the city’s most innovative chefs and vendors. From traditional fillings to gourmet twists, it’s a day dedicated to the flavors that define our streets.

A Feast for the Senses
The Jozi Kota Festival is more than just a food market; it is a full-scale cultural experience. While the kota is the star of the show, the festival brings together a diverse range of local talent to keep the energy high:

Culinary Innovation: Dozens of vendors competing to serve the most unique and delicious kotas in Jozi.
Live Entertainment: A curated lineup of local DJs and performers providing the perfect backdrop for a day of feasting.
The Atmosphere: A high-energy, community-driven vibe that celebrates the pulse of Johannesburg.
Family Fun in the Heart of Newtown
Held at The Station, the festival offers a central and accessible location for foodies from across the province. The venue provides an industrial-chic setting that perfectly complements the urban street food theme.

Kids’ Zone: A dedicated, secure area featuring jumping castles and face painting to keep the little ones entertained.
Craft Market: Explore a selection of local artisanal goods and lifestyle products between bites.
The Social Hub: Plenty of seating and communal areas designed for sharing a meal and making new friends.

Why This Festival is a Johannesburg Staple
Because the Jozi Kota Festival focuses on a dish that is deeply rooted in South African heritage, it attracts a diverse and enthusiastic crowd. Furthermore, the event’s commitment to supporting local SMMEs means that every kota you buy supports a local business owner.
